Structuring the Web site is first step towards building the corporate Web site. Structuring includes creating a folder that includes all our picture files, text files and database files in their respective folders included in main folder, which also includes home page.
To better understand the concept of Structuring Web Site, you could use Dreamweaver tutorial file which is part of the package. In Dreamweaver's main menu choose Site > Open Site, then select Tutorial - Dreamweaver. Tutorial - Dreamweaver site links to Compass Site files located in Dreamweaver 4/Tutorial folder. After selecting local site, skip to Create the Site Home Page section of the Dreamweaver tutorial.
